3. Canadian Universities with Online MBA / Hybrid MBA Programs

Here are some of the well-known Canadian universities that offer online MBA or hybrid MBA options, along with program highlights.

UniversityProgramFormatKey Features
University Canada West (UCW)Online MBAFully online2 years; has specializations in AI & Machine Learning Leadership, Supply Chain Management, Business Analytics. Accredited by ACBSP & NCMA. (ucanwest.ca)
Carleton University (Sprott School of Business)MBA (online)100% onlineDuration 12-24 months; multiple start dates; pay per course model; concentrations like Business Analytics, Financial Management, Management & Change. AACSB accredited. (Carleton)
Athabasca UniversityOnline MBAFully onlineOne of the oldest online MBA providers in Canada. Offers flexible pacing. (Wikipedia)
University of FrederictonOnline MBAFully onlineOffers many specialty tracks: Global Leadership, Innovation Leadership, Social Enterprise Leadership, etc. (Wikipedia)
University of Guelph (Lang School of Business)Online MBA for Working ProfessionalsFully online2-year format; 7-week online courses; strong emphasis on sustainability and ethical leadership. (graduatestudies.uoguelph.ca)

4. Program Details: Duration, Cost, Structure, Specializations

Here’s a deeper look at how these programs compare along several dimensions:

ProgramApprox DurationApprox Cost / TuitionStructure / DeliverySpecializations / Unique Features
Carleton University Online MBA12-24 monthsCAD ~15,000 (for Ontario residents) (Carleton)100% online, asynchronous coursework; pay per course; several concentrations. (Carleton)Business Analytics; Financial Management; Management & Change.
UCW Online MBA2 years(~CAD 38,000 for international students, domestic fees vary) (ucanwest.ca)Fully online; multiple electives; specializations; capstone; certifications embedded. (ucanwest.ca)AI & ML Leadership; Supply Chain Management; Business Analytics; Digital marketing certifications etc.
Athabasca University~2.5-3 years (part-time)CAD ~35,000-40,000 (CampusCybercafe)Flexible pacing; fully online; optional in-person? Historically very remote/distance. (Wikipedia)Leadership, global business etc.
University of Fredericton2-3 yearsCAD ~25,000-32,000 (CampusCybercafe)100% online; interactive virtual classrooms; various leadership tracks. (Wikipedia)Many tracks: HR, innovation, social enterprise, real estate, business analytics etc.
Guelph (Lang) Online MBA2 yearsNot always clearly published for international or online; but on-par with similar Canadian schools (likely CAD $40,000-CAD $50,000 approx)7-week course blocks online (one course at a time) to suit working professionals. Emphasis on responsible management, sustainability. (graduatestudies.uoguelph.ca)Sustainable business, ethical leadership, etc.

9. FAQs

Q: Are online MBAs from Canadian universities respected by employers?
A: Yes, especially from accredited universities. Their value depends on the school’s reputation, your performance, and how you demonstrate the learning in your work.

Q: Can international students use Canadian online MBA programs to get work permits like PGWP?
A: Not always. Some online programs are not eligible for PGWP. Example: UCW’s online MBA doesn’t grant PGWP eligibility. (ucanwest.ca) Always check IRCC (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ada) rules for your chosen program.

Q: How long do online MBAs in Canada usually take?
A: Varies. Many take ~2 years, though some fully online ones can be completed in 12-24 months depending on course load. For more flexible pacing, could stretch 2.5-3 years.

Q: How expensive are these programs for international students?
A: Costs vary widely. Some are more affordable; others get expensive especially for international fees + additional costs. Always check both domestic vs international tuition.
